Backlight Compensation Function
This prevents the subject from being recorded too
darkly when backlit. (Backlight is the light that shines
from behind the subject being recorded.)
Set to Tape/Card Recording Mode.

To Select the Color For Fade in/out
The color which appears in fading pictures can be
selected.
1 Set [ ADVANCED] >> [ FADE COLOR]
>> [BLACK] or [WHITE].
Notes:
When setting the Iris manually, the Backlight
Compensation Function does not work.
If you operate the [OFF/ON] Switch or Mode Dial,
the Backlight Compensation Function is canceled.
